WebJul 1, 2024 · The early identification of labyrinthitis ossificans is important for hearing preservation. Ossification of the cochlea could hinder, or even make impossible, the cochlear implant placement [1]. Nonenhanced CT is useful in the ossification stage, finding an increased density within the semicircular canals and cochlea.

WebJun 17, 2024 · Labyrinthitis (say: “lab-uh-rinth-eye-tus”) is a condition that affects a part of the inner ear called the labyrinth. Normally, the labyrinth helps you keep your balance. When it gets swollen, the labyrinth doesn’t work properly. This makes it so that your brain doesn’t get the right balance signals.
